Runbook: Hot-reload procedure — Skelve Gateway

For the release manager: the gateway supports hot-reloading of configuration without a restart. Send the reload signal only after validation passes; a malformed file is rejected and the previous config stays active. Reloads apply within ten seconds and are logged with a version stamp. Confirm the active values afterward against the expected set shown here.

deployment values, yadup-kadug:
[sorys]
port = 5672
team = noveth
host = sorys.orvexcorp.example
region = south-4
access_code = ac_deddc1
timeout_ms = 1500

**14:22 UTC** — The Bramblefox firmware update channel for Hollowell devices began serving stale manifests after a cache-layer deploy. Plugin authors targeting channel `stable-7` received build 7.1.3 instead of 7.1.5, breaking API shims. Mitigation shipped at 14:51. The affected deploy is identified by the trace token below.

session token of taduf-tahog = htk4_91a1

Quarterly Planning Note — Transition to Annual Billing. From Q3, Mervale Systems will move all new contracts to annual billing, with existing monthly accounts migrating at renewal. Branch managers should brief staff on the revised discount bands and ensure renewal conversations begin sixty days out. Exception requests route through regional finance. The strategic reasoning behind this change is set out in the confidential note that follows.

management briefing: Project Ulavan slips by two quarters because of the staffing delay.

Ticket #— Floor 9 Opening Prep, Brindlemoor House

Hi facilities folks, Floor 9 opens to staff next Monday and we need a few things squared away before then. Lift access is live, but the two side doors by the kitchenette are still on the old lock config — please reprogram them before Friday. Also, signage for the quiet rooms hasn't arrived, so pop up the temporary printed ones for now. Until the badge readers sync, the interim door code for Floor 9 is below.

door code, bajop-bajog: bdg-DSWAC-43621